新聞中心
MYSQL中同一個(gè)數(shù)據(jù)庫(kù)中的兩個(gè)表中的數(shù)據(jù)怎樣合并?
1、可以將兩個(gè)表中的數(shù)據(jù)提出來(lái)(重復(fù)的過(guò)濾)寫(xiě)入一個(gè)臨時(shí)表中,清空這兩個(gè)表,再將臨時(shí)表的數(shù)據(jù)回寫(xiě)入這兩個(gè)表里面。為防出錯(cuò),請(qǐng)先備份數(shù)據(jù)庫(kù)再操作。
創(chuàng)新互聯(lián)堅(jiān)持“要么做到,要么別承諾”的工作理念,服務(wù)領(lǐng)域包括:成都網(wǎng)站建設(shè)、網(wǎng)站設(shè)計(jì)、企業(yè)官網(wǎng)、英文網(wǎng)站、手機(jī)端網(wǎng)站、網(wǎng)站推廣等服務(wù),滿足客戶于互聯(lián)網(wǎng)時(shí)代的麥蓋提網(wǎng)站設(shè)計(jì)、移動(dòng)媒體設(shè)計(jì)的需求,幫助企業(yè)找到有效的互聯(lián)網(wǎng)解決方案。努力成為您成熟可靠的網(wǎng)絡(luò)建設(shè)合作伙伴!
2、然后查詢兩張表的所有字段(字段位置可根據(jù)情況,擺放先后順序),然后查詢出的結(jié)果就是你想要的那個(gè)完整的表。最后可以查詢結(jié)果插入到新的表格。
3、首先建立關(guān)系(例如兩個(gè)表中的id相同的1對(duì)1關(guān)系),然后建立一個(gè)生成表查詢,之后把所有字段加入查詢中,執(zhí)行該查詢,即可生成合并后的新表。
同一mysql數(shù)據(jù)庫(kù).兩個(gè)表怎么合并在一個(gè)里面
1、合并的第一個(gè)步驟,是在修改【表1】結(jié)構(gòu),增加【經(jīng)驗(yàn)值】列,可以寫(xiě)SQL,也可以在管理界面點(diǎn)鼠標(biāo)完成。
2、你想要的結(jié)果很簡(jiǎn)單就可以實(shí)現(xiàn)的,你只需要將兩張表通過(guò)文件的ID進(jìn)行關(guān)聯(lián),然后查詢兩張表的所有字段(字段位置可根據(jù)情況,擺放先后順序),然后查詢出的結(jié)果就是你想要的那個(gè)完整的表。最后可以查詢結(jié)果插入到新的表格。
3、以MySQL數(shù)據(jù)庫(kù)為例,通過(guò)SQL命令行將某個(gè)表的所有數(shù)據(jù)或指定字段的數(shù)據(jù),導(dǎo)入到目標(biāo)表中。此方法對(duì)于SQLServer數(shù)據(jù)庫(kù),也就是T-SQL來(lái)說(shuō),同樣適用 。
4、實(shí)現(xiàn)字段合并 首先建立關(guān)系(例如兩個(gè)表中的ID相同的1對(duì)1關(guān)系),然后建立一個(gè)生成表查詢,之后把所有字段加入查詢中,執(zhí)行該查詢,即可生成合并后的新表。
mysql如何合并查詢多個(gè)相同數(shù)據(jù)結(jié)構(gòu)庫(kù)的表輸出來(lái)結(jié)果?
INSERT_METHOD選項(xiàng),這個(gè)選項(xiàng)的可取值是NO、FIRST、LAST 然后使用select * from log_merge就可以訪問(wèn)所有的表了。
以MySQL數(shù)據(jù)庫(kù)為例,通過(guò)SQL命令行將某個(gè)表的所有數(shù)據(jù)或指定字段的數(shù)據(jù),導(dǎo)入到目標(biāo)表中。此方法對(duì)于SQLServer數(shù)據(jù)庫(kù),也就是T-SQL來(lái)說(shuō),同樣適用 。
然后查詢兩張表的所有字段(字段位置可根據(jù)情況,擺放先后順序),然后查詢出的結(jié)果就是你想要的那個(gè)完整的表。最后可以查詢結(jié)果插入到新的表格。
MySQL InnoDB 表數(shù)據(jù)頁(yè)或者二級(jí)索引頁(yè)(簡(jiǎn)稱(chēng)數(shù)據(jù)頁(yè)或者索引頁(yè))的合并與分裂對(duì) InnoDB 表整體性能影響很大;數(shù)據(jù)頁(yè)的這類(lèi)操作越多,對(duì) InnoDB 表數(shù)據(jù)寫(xiě)入的影響越大。
mysql怎么合并兩個(gè)有重復(fù)數(shù)據(jù)的表?
1、字段1,字段2,字段3 FROM A;/* 需要注意的是: 字段必須相同。 B表的主鍵字段必須是自增。 缺點(diǎn): 目前有重復(fù)數(shù)據(jù)也會(huì)插入到B表,如另有需求,請(qǐng)自行查詢。
2、要將兩表合并,必須要有相同的字段和字段數(shù)據(jù),ID主鍵自動(dòng)增加無(wú)疑是最好的選擇。所以,在兩個(gè)表中,都應(yīng)該有id主鍵自動(dòng)增加的字段。
3、實(shí)現(xiàn)字段合并 首先建立關(guān)系(例如兩個(gè)表中的ID相同的1對(duì)1關(guān)系),然后建立一個(gè)生成表查詢,之后把所有字段加入查詢中,執(zhí)行該查詢,即可生成合并后的新表。
4、select name,sum(count)from(select name, count from A union all select name, count from B )group by name 說(shuō)明:將兩表的查詢結(jié)果進(jìn)行不去重復(fù)結(jié)合,作為新表查詢,按照name分組求和。
5、A、B兩表合并可以使用insert into 。
mysql中,2個(gè)不同數(shù)據(jù),同一結(jié)構(gòu)的表,如何合并數(shù)據(jù)
直接先用union all合并所有的表,再包一層select語(yǔ)句,將合并表作為子表查詢,加where條件即可,如果記錄重復(fù),可以加distinct關(guān)鍵字去重。
你可以把某個(gè)數(shù)據(jù)庫(kù)導(dǎo)出,然后導(dǎo)入到另一個(gè)數(shù)據(jù)庫(kù)。或者把兩個(gè)數(shù)據(jù)庫(kù)都導(dǎo)出,然后導(dǎo)入一個(gè)新的數(shù)據(jù)庫(kù)。因?yàn)閷?dǎo)出數(shù)據(jù)庫(kù),插入時(shí),系統(tǒng)默認(rèn)是把外鍵先關(guān)閉的,所以不用擔(dān)心關(guān)聯(lián)問(wèn)題。
我是sql初學(xué)者。解決你的問(wèn)題前我想問(wèn)下,兩個(gè)表有沒(méi)有主鍵,更新數(shù)據(jù)是依據(jù)id還是姓名。
首先建立關(guān)系(例如兩個(gè)表中的ID相同的1對(duì)1關(guān)系),然后建立一個(gè)生成表查詢,之后把所有字段加入查詢中,執(zhí)行該查詢,即可生成合并后的新表。
mysql怎么合并一個(gè)庫(kù)中的所有表合并查詢?
直接先用union all合并所有的表,再包一層select語(yǔ)句,將合并表作為子表查詢,加where條件即可,如果記錄重復(fù),可以加distinct關(guān)鍵字去重。
合并的規(guī)則是什么,用主鍵?主鍵重復(fù)如何處理;你備份的是什么格式的文件,SQL語(yǔ)句?導(dǎo)入到MYSQL中再做處理;詳細(xì)說(shuō)明,貼出相關(guān)文本內(nèi)容。
您好.mysql中,2個(gè)不同數(shù)據(jù),同一結(jié)構(gòu)的表,如何合并數(shù)據(jù)。合并的規(guī)則是什么,用主鍵?主鍵重復(fù)如何處理;你備份的是什么格式的文件,SQL語(yǔ)句?導(dǎo)入到MYSQL中再做處理;詳細(xì)說(shuō)明,貼出相關(guān)文本內(nèi)容。
Article_UserID) as User_Count From My_User as U left join My_Artcile as A on U.My_User_ID = A.My_Article_UserID;-- 查詢兩張表,分別取別名 U 和 A。左聯(lián)A表查詢。
實(shí)現(xiàn)字段合并 首先建立關(guān)系(例如兩個(gè)表中的ID相同的1對(duì)1關(guān)系),然后建立一個(gè)生成表查詢,之后把所有字段加入查詢中,執(zhí)行該查詢,即可生成合并后的新表。
您好.以前有高人寫(xiě)過(guò)類(lèi)似的:select id,group_concat(re_id order by re_id separator ,) as re_id from tablename group by id 答題不易,互相理解,您的采納是我前進(jìn)的動(dòng)力,感謝您。
文章名稱(chēng):mysql數(shù)據(jù)表怎么合并 mysql如何合并結(jié)果集
文章鏈接:http://www.ef60e0e.cn/article/disgggc.html